ODAIBA DRONE SHOW 2026: A New Era of Night Entertainment



The ODAIBA DRONE SHOW 2026 is set to ignite the night sky of Odaiba with its stunning display from September 4th to 6th and again from September 18th to 22nd, transforming Tokyo Bay into a canvas of light and color. Organized by the ODAIBA DRONE SHOW Executive Committee, which includes Drone Show Japan, headquartered in Kanazawa, and ULTRA PLANET, located in Shibuya, this innovative event will bring together beloved characters from games, anime, and films, all on a breathtaking digital stage made possible by advanced drone technology.

Celebrating Japanese Culture with Modern Technology



The event is themed around the traditional Japanese celebration of Tsukimi, or moon viewing, which expresses gratitude for the autumn harvest. Under this premise, 1,000 drones will create a visual representation known as the "Pixel Moon" amidst the stunning backdrop of Tokyo Tower and the Rainbow Bridge. This extraordinary celebration highlights the fusion of technology and culture, presenting a unique spectacle for audiences regardless of their age or origin.

A Collaboration with the Tokyo Aqua Symphony



One of the key attractions at the event is the collaboration with the Tokyo Aqua Symphony, renowned as one of the world's largest fountain installations. The dynamic synchronization between the drone light show and the fountain's water displays, enhanced by lasers and lights, promises to offer an immersive experience that amplifies the scale and grandeur of the performance, creating a captivating atmosphere in the night sky. Each evening will feature two performances, each lasting around 30 minutes and showcasing different programs—TRACK A and TRACK B—ensuring that visitors can immerse themselves in multiple unique experiences.

Features of the Show



Drone Height and Visual Impact



The drones will soar to heights of 125 meters, almost matching the height of the Rainbow Bridge's main tower. This high-altitude performance allows for an unparalleled view against the vibrant Tokyo skyline, offering spectators a surreal blend of nature and technology at its finest.

Featured Characters



Expect to see beloved characters such as:
  • - Sonic the Hedgehog (35th Anniversary)
  • - Tokyo Revengers (Anime Series)
  • - Puyo Puyo (35th Anniversary)
  • - Hypnosis Mic -Division Rap Battle-
  • - Persona Series (30th Anniversary)
  • - Godzilla-0.0 (Film Release)

These characters will light up the night, bringing joy to fans of all ages.

Event Details


  • - Dates: September 4-6, 18-22, 2026
  • - Time: Performances at 7 PM and 9 PM each day
  • - Venue: Odaiba Marine Park, in front of the Marine House and more
  • - Admission: Free
  • - Organizer: ODAIBA DRONE SHOW Executive Committee
  • - Social Media: Follow on X: @OdaibaDroneShow & Instagram: @odaibadroneshow

Weather Contingency


Be advised that the event's scheduling may change due to inclement weather such as strong winds or rain.
